When selling a used smartphone, performing a factory reset is one of the most important steps to ensure your personal data is protected and to maximize the device’s resale value. A thorough reset not only secures your privacy but also gives the new owner a fresh start, making your device more appealing and easier to sell.
Why Factory Reset Matters
Factory resetting your phone removes all personal information, apps, and settings. This process restores the device to its original state, which helps prevent data theft and ensures the new owner doesn’t encounter any of your personal data. Additionally, a clean device appears well-maintained, which can increase its resale value.
Preparing Your Phone for Reset
- Back up important data such as contacts, photos, and documents to a cloud service or computer.
- Sign out of all accounts, including email, social media, and app accounts.
- Remove any SD cards or external storage devices.
- Charge your phone to at least 50% to ensure the reset process completes without interruption.
How to Factory Reset Your Phone
Android Devices
The process varies slightly depending on the device manufacturer and Android version, but generally follows these steps:
- Open the Settings app.
- Scroll down and tap on “System” or “General Management”.
- Select “Reset” or “Reset options”.
- Tap on “Factory data reset”.
- Confirm your choice and enter your PIN or password if prompted.
- Wait for the device to erase all data and restart.
iPhone Devices
For iPhones, the reset process is straightforward:
- Open the Settings app.
- Tap on your Apple ID at the top of the menu.
- Select “Find My” and turn it off if enabled.
- Go back to Settings and tap “General”.
- Scroll down and tap “Reset”.
- Choose “Erase All Content and Settings”.
- Enter your Apple ID password if prompted and confirm.
- The iPhone will erase everything and restart as new.
Post-Reset Tips for Sellers
After completing the factory reset, consider the following to prepare your device for sale:
- Clean the device exterior with a soft cloth.
- Take high-quality photos from multiple angles.
- Gather original accessories, packaging, and receipts if available.
- Set a competitive price based on current market values.
- Write a clear and honest product description highlighting the device’s condition and features.
